Creating a Debt Schedule

When you create a debt schedule, you can associate a balance sheet and income/expense statement, and then enter loan information in the standard fields, and in the custom fields created by your system administrator.

1.    Navigate to the Debt Schedule screen by selecting the Loans menu option.

2.    Click the Create New Debt Schedule link to display the Debt Schedule Setup dialog box.

Balance Sheet

The selected balance sheet will be linked to the debt schedule. This enables certain amounts entered in the debt schedule to appear in relevant charts of account on the balance sheet when you select the To BS check box on the Debt Schedule screen.

Select a balance sheet.

Income / Expense

The selected income/expense statement will be linked to the debt schedule. This enables certain amounts entered in the schedule to appear in relevant charts of account on the income/expense statement when you select the To I/E check box on the Debt Schedule screen.

Select an income/expense statement.

3.    Click Save.

4.    On the Debt Schedule screen, click either the Our Debt or Other Debt tab to add loan information for your debts or debts of other financial institutions.  

5.    Enter your loan information as below:

6.    In the drop-down list to the right of the Add button, select the type of loan you are adding:

    •  Ag.—Agriculture

    •  Com.—Commercial

    •  Pers.—Personal

7.     Click Add to add the loan to the debt schedule.
